UH Law Center Celebrates Its First Skadden Fellow Carola Aisenberg
Jan. 21, 2026—University of Houston Law Center third-year student Carola Aisenberg has been awarded the highly prestigious Skadden Fellowship, one of the nation’s most competitive, public interest fellowships. Aisenberg, the first UHLC student to receive this honor, is one of 34 fellows selected from 20 law schools nationwide. They will each pursue projects to address unmet civil needs for people living in poverty in the United States.

UHLC student Grayem publishes wind rights article in Texas Lawyer
April 23, 2024 — University of Houston Law Center student Hannah Grayem was featured in Texas Lawyer for an article on the severability of wind rights. Such rights were recently recognized for the first time under Texas law. Grayem co-authored the piece titled “Are Wind Rights A New Stick in the Bundle?” during her summer associate placement at King & Spalding.

Barrett Schitka
Barrett Schitka has a pipeline to study in two North American energy capitals and to earn two law degrees. He is the first law student in the new International Energy Lawyers Program (IELP), a dual program sponsored by the University of Houston Law Center and the University of Calgary Faculty of Law. IELP allows graduates to earn American and Canadian law degrees and to sit for bar exams in both countries. more...
